无论是个人开发者、中小企业还是大型企业,MySQL都能提供稳定可靠的数据存储和访问服务
本文将详细介绍如何在Windows操作系统上下载并配置MySQL,确保您能够顺利搭建起自己的数据库环境
一、MySQL版本选择 在下载MySQL之前,首先需要确定所需版本
MySQL主要分为社区版、企业版、集群版和高级集群版四大类
其中,社区版开源免费,适用于大多数普通用户;企业版则需付费,但提供了更多的功能和更完备的技术支持,适合对数据库功能和可靠性要求较高的企业客户
集群版和高级集群版则用于架设集群服务器,满足高可用性和负载均衡等需求
对于大多数个人开发者和小型企业来说,MySQL社区版已经足够满足需求
因此,本文将重点介绍如何下载和配置MySQL社区版
二、下载MySQL安装包 下载MySQL安装包是搭建数据库环境的第一步
虽然MySQL官网提供了丰富的下载资源,但由于其是国外网站,下载速度可能较慢
为了确保下载效率和安全性,建议从可靠的第三方资源或国内镜像站点下载
当然,如果您不介意等待较长的下载时间,也可以直接从MySQL官网下载
下载步骤如下: 1. 打开浏览器,访问MySQL官网(【https://www.mysql.com】(https://www.mysql.com))
2. 在官网首页点击“DOWNLOADS”链接
3. 在下载页面,选择“MySQL Community(GPL) Downloads”
4. 在“MySQL Community Server”部分,选择适合您的操作系统和版本的安装包
对于Windows用户,推荐下载MSI安装程序,因为它提供了图形化的安装向导过程,使用起来更加简单
5. 点击“Go to Download Page”按钮,进入下载页面
6. 在下载页面,选择适合的安装包并点击下载链接
下载完成后,找到下载的文件并双击进行安装
三、安装MySQL 安装MySQL的过程相对简单,只需按照安装向导的提示逐步操作即可
以下是安装步骤的详细说明: 1. 双击下载的MySQL安装包,打开安装向导
2. 在“Choosing a Setup Type”(选择安装类型)窗口中,选择“Custom”(自定义)安装类型
这样可以自定义需要安装的产品和安装路径
3. 在“Select Products”(选择产品)窗口中,选择需要安装的产品
例如,如果您只需要MySQL服务器,可以选择“MySQL Server”并单击“→”添加按钮将其添加到安装列表中
此时,如果希望自定义安装目录,可以选中对应的产品并单击“Advanced Options”(高级选项)超链接来设置安装目录和数据存储目录
4. 在选择好要安装的产品后,单击“Next”(下一步)进入确认窗口
确认无误后,单击“Execute”(执行)按钮开始安装
5. 安装过程中,安装向导会提示您输入MySQL的root密码
请务必记住此密码,因为它是访问MySQL数据库的唯一凭证
如果忘记密码,可能导致数据丢失或需要复杂的恢复过程
6. 安装完成后,在“Status”(状态)列表下将显示“Complete”(安装完成)
此时,您可以单击“Next”(下一步)按钮继续配置MySQL服务器或单击“Finish”(完成)按钮退出安装向导
四、配置MySQL 安装完成后,需要对MySQL服务器进行配置
配置过程包括设置端口号、选择加密方式、设置root密码等
以下是配置步骤的详细说明: 1. 在安装向导的最后一步或退出安装向导后,单击“Next”(下一步)按钮进入产品配置窗口
2. 在MySQL服务器类型配置窗口中,选择适合您的服务器类型
例如,如果您将MySQL安装在个人用桌面工作站上,可以选择“Development Machine”(开发机器);如果您将MySQL安装在服务器上并与其他服务器应用程序一起运行,可以选择“Server Machine”(服务器);如果您只运行MySQL服务,可以选择“Dedicated Machine”(专用服务器)
3. 在设置授权方式窗口中,选择适合的授权方式
MySQL 8.0提供了新的授权方式,采用SHA256基础的密码加密方法;您也可以选择传统授权方法以保留5.x版本的兼容性
4. 在设置服务器root超级管理员的密码窗口中,输入两次同样的登录密码以确认
此外,您还可以通过“Add User”按钮添加其他用户并指定用户名、允许登录的主机和用户角色等
5. 在设置服务器名称窗口中,输入服务名以在Windows服务列表中出现
同时,您还可以选择是否开机自启动服务以及使用标准系统用户还是自定义用户来运行MySQL服务
6. 在确认设置服务器窗口中,检查所有配置信息是否正确
确认无误后,单击“Execute”(执行)按钮开始应用配置
7. 配置完成后,单击“Finish”(完成)按钮退出配置向导
此时,MySQL服务器已经安装并配置完成
五、验证安装与配置 为了确保MySQL已经成功安装并配置,需要进行验证
验证步骤包括打开MySQL命令行客户端并输入root密码以登录数据库
如果能够成功登录并看到MySQL命令行界面,则说明安装和配置成功
验证步骤如下: 1. 在Windows搜索栏中输入“MySQL”并打开MySQL命令行客户端
2. 在命令行客户端中输入之前设置的root密码并按回车键
如果密码正确且MySQL服务器正在运行,则您将看到MySQL命令行界面
3. 在MySQL命令行界面中,您可以输入SQL语句来管理数据库和数据表等
例如,您可以输入“SHOW DATABASES;”语句来查看所有数据库列表
六、环境变量配置(可选) 为了方便在命令行中运行MySQL命令而无需输入完整路径,可以将MySQL的安装路径添加到系统的环境变量中
以下是环境变量配置的步骤: 1. 在桌面上右键单击“此电脑”或“我的电脑”图标并选择“属性”
2. 在系统属性窗口中单击“高级系统设置”链接
3. 在系统属性高级选项卡中单击“环境变量”按钮
4. 在环境变量窗口中找到系统变量部分并选择“Path”变量然后单击“编辑”按钮
5. 在编辑环境变量